Deportation officers made nearly 1,000 arrests across the country Sunday, marking the largest number of single-day arrests only six days into the Trump administration and far surpassing the Biden administration average.
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agents made 956 arrests, according to an announcement from the agency. This figure has already outpaced the average daily ICE apprehension rate of the Biden administration in fiscal year 2024, which stood at roughly 310 daily arrests, according to figures previously released by the agency.
